Managing Pain and Pain



You need to take over-the-counter pain drug to aid manage any kind of pain you might experience after your dental implant treatment. It prevails to experience some degree of discomfort or discomfort following the surgical treatment. Taking over the counter discomfort drug, such as ibuprofen or acetaminophen, can help reduce any post-operative pain. Make certain to comply with the recommended dosage instructions and speak with your dentist or pharmacist if you have any type of worries.

Additionally, using a cold pack to the damaged area for 15 mins at a time can help reduce swelling and provide short-lived relief. It is necessary to rest and prevent difficult tasks for the initial few days to permit your body to recover.

Oral Hygiene and Cleansing Techniques



Maintaining appropriate dental health and regularly cleansing your oral implant are essential for a successful recuperation.

After obtaining a dental implant, it is necessary to follow appropriate dental health methods to guarantee the longevity and health of your dental implant. Brush your teeth at least two times a day making use of a soft-bristled tooth brush and a non-abrasive tooth paste. Be gentle around the implant area to avoid triggering any damage.

Furthermore, flossing is important to get rid of plaque and food fragments that can accumulate around the dental implant. Use a floss threader or interdental brush to tidy between the implant and adjacent teeth.

In addition, washing with an antimicrobial mouth wash can help reduce microorganisms and preserve dental wellness.

Regular dental exams and expert cleansings are additionally necessary to keep an eye on the problem of your dental implant and deal with any possible concerns.

Dietary Considerations and Restrictions



When it pertains to your diet regimen after getting an oral implant, it's important to be conscious of particular factors to consider and constraints. While you might be eager to return to your normal consuming routines, it's important to provide your implant time to recover effectively.

In the first few days after surgery, you need to stay with a soft or fluid diet to stay clear of placing too much stress on the dental implant site. This suggests avoiding hard, crunchy, or sticky foods that can possibly dislodge or damage the implant. It's additionally suggested to avoid warm foods and beverages, as they can enhance pain and swelling.

As your dental implant heals, you can gradually reestablish solid foods, but be cautious and chew on the opposite side of your mouth to avoid any type of unneeded stress on the dental implant.
